588 * Code to make ctrl+c and ctrl+y working.
589 * The problem starts with the synchronous case where after lib$spawn is
590 * called any input will go to the child. But with input re-directed,
591 * both control characters won't make it to any of the programs, neither
592 * the spawning nor to the spawned one. Hence the caller needs to spawn
593 * with CLI$M_NOWAIT to NOT give up the input focus. A sys$waitfr
594 * has to follow to simulate the wanted synchronous behaviour.
595 * The next problem is ctrl+y which isn't caught by the crtl and
596 * therefore isn't converted to SIGQUIT (for a signal handler which is
597 * already established). The only way to catch ctrl+y, is an AST
598 * assigned to the input channel. But ctrl+y handling of DCL needs to be
599 * disabled, otherwise it will handle it. Not to mention the previous
600 * ctrl+y handling of DCL needs to be re-established before make exits.
601 * One more: At the time of LIB$SPAWN signals are blocked. SIGQUIT will
602 * make it to the signal handler after the child "normally" terminates.
603 * This isn't enough. It seems reasonable for simple command lines like
604 * a 'cc foobar.c' spawned in a subprocess but it is unacceptable for
605 * spawning make. Therefore we need to abort the process in the AST.
607 * Prior to the spawn it is checked if an AST is already set up for
608 * ctrl+y, if not one is set up for a channel to SYS$COMMAND. In general
609 * this will work except if make is run in a batch environment, but there
610 * nobody can press ctrl+y. During the setup the DCL handling of ctrl+y
611 * is disabled and an exit handler is established to re-enable it.
612 * If the user interrupts with ctrl+y, the assigned AST will fire, force
613 * an abort to the subprocess and signal SIGQUIT, which will be caught by
614 * the already established handler and will bring us back to common code.
615 * After the spawn (now /nowait) a sys$waitfr simulates the /wait and
616 * enables the ctrl+y be delivered to this code. And the ctrl+c too,
617 * which the crtl converts to SIGINT and which is caught by the common
618 * signal handler. Because signals were blocked before entering this code
619 * sys$waitfr will always complete and the SIGQUIT will be processed after
620 * it (after termination of the current block, somewhere in common code).
621 * And SIGINT too will be delayed. That is ctrl+c can only abort when the
622 * current command completes. Anyway it's better than nothing :-)
